Description

A charming view of the Ruins of Quin Abbey in County Clare in the South West of Ireland. Artist name inscribed to the mount. Label verso with provenance details: by family descent to Stephen Lockhart CMG. Private Collection, UK. The present drawing comes from a collection reportedly sold at Sotheby's in 1979, the majority of which were overseas scenes. Presented in a gilt frame and wash line mount. On paper.

Condition

There is light foxing. Very small loss to the upper left corner of the paper. Light wear to the gilt frame.
